Painfully Comforting
Just wanted to share a really rough couple of weeks… My mom being hospitalized two weeks ago, my book launching on Thursday, my mom passing yesterday and my birthday today. I was built with strength, provided by God and cured by my mom. So I can handle pressure. Especially under stress. I wrote the tribute below from the hospital room while watching her… 💝💝💝💝💝💝💝💝💝💝💝💝 The clock ticked slower there. In that wing of a medical center in São Paulo, time stopped being in a hurry. You heard every tick. You felt the space between them. And you would have given anything to fill that gap with something other than what was coming. My mom (Mamis to us) spent her last fourteen days in that hospital. Tough as nails to the very end. Eighty years old, on the 21st floor, fighting until her last breath. Giving out a little more each morning, her breathing heavier and heavier, her strength fading like a tide going out and not coming back. That fight came from somewhere deeper. She had a rough life. Unfortunately, her last weeks followed suit. On the flip side, you don't raise two kids who turn out better than okay without being tough as nails yourself. On that wing, nobody talked about it out loud, but everybody knew. No patient walks out of that floor alive. It's not a hospital ward. It's a waiting room for the inevitable. A death sentence with soft sheets and the kindest nurses and doctors you will ever meet in your life. They are not there to perform miracles. They are there to provide abundant love to the patients and their families. I know death. I've been close to it four times myself. But here's the thing: facing your own death and watching someone you love face theirs are not the same thing. Not even close. In those four instances, I was the main actor. I had my own will to throw at it. My own body to fight with. There was something to do. With my mom, I was the spectator. And that's a completely different weight. You can't fight it. You can't fix it. You can't trade places, nor can you buy more time or hope.
